Western United, from Australia, founded in 2018is a football club. On Sport Eden, you can follow Western United's fixtures, results, squad information, and complete statistics. Get live scores, match updates, player stats, and detailed analysis for every Western United game.

Home Stadium: Western United plays home matches at AAMI Park in Melbourne (Capacity: 30,050).

Competitions:

Western United is participating in A-League, Australia Cup, Friendlies Clubs, and OFC Champions League this season.
